Output d345870a3d9d7243736cb361225601af71196d1950eabb07ee4dd0a9ef666ea7:1

value
23592696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3286582860934f58be2279b7a4eb3d989ead57a4 OP_EQUAL
address
MCWJxS1CMp6UWozbuXSZVPPHd79gY9MQQF
transaction
d345870a3d9d7243736cb361225601af71196d1950eabb07ee4dd0a9ef666ea7
spent
true